Warning Signs You Need Burst Pipe Water Removal in Vandalia, OH

Catching signs of water damage early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some warning signs you shouldn’t ignore: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, musty odors can show the presence of mold and mildew in your home. If you notice a persistent, unpleasant smell, it’s a sign that you need to address the issue ASAP.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age, particularly if the damage is caused by a burst pipe. Our team can help you identify the source of the problem and provide a solution to fix the issue.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can show water damage, particularly if the damage is caused by a burst pipe. Our team can help you identify the source of the problem and provide a solution to fix the issue.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Water stains or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any of these signs, it’s a sign that you need to address the issue ASAP.

Burst Pipe Water Removal Cost in Vandalia, OH

The cost of burst pipe water removal in Vandalia, OH can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and other local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, amount of water damage, and equipment required.
Drying and d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, amount of water damage, and equipment required.
Repair and rest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, amount of water damage, and materials required.
Antimicrobial treatment $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, amount of water damage, and equipment required.
Final inspection and certification $100 – $500 Size of affected area, amount of water damage, and equipment required.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and free estimates are available. Our team will work with you to provide a customized solution for your unique needs and budget.
